Problem overview

Some Land Rover Discovery Sport owners report experiencing battery drain issues due to the computer system not shutting off after locking the doors, which can lead to warnings like "battery low, please start engine" and other electrical malfunctions. This problem may result from a parasitic drain or a system failure to completely power down, causing the battery to deplete overnight. Additionally, some users have reported that the vehicle unexpectedly shuts off while driving and does not restart for 20 minutes or more, indicating a significant power drain. Even after battery replacement, the drain issue can persist, particularly when the vehicle is parked overnight, sometimes leading to a complete failure to start. Furthermore, the computer system may disable certain functions, such as remote unlock features, to conserve power when it detects a low battery. To address these concerns, it is crucial for owners to diagnose the root cause of the electrical drain, which may involve checking for faulty wiring or malfunctioning components, and seeking assistance from a qualified mechanic or dealership familiar with Land Rover vehicles.
